Default door handle help

i have a 90 s-10 blazer 2-door. The other day I tried opening it after it snowed and was frozen shut. Now, it won't open from the outside. I took the panel off to see if something is disconnected, but it doesn't feel like it. Do I need to replace the handle or am I just missing something?

Can you see the jaws on the jam-side of the door moving when you use either of the door opener handles? Maybe they just need a major lubing? I would check the linkages inside the door, there is a vertical bar that connects the outer handle to the jaw mechanism that holds the door shut.
